Output def6c25afb40d18df0ba72427a5a217996a0aa29d06ba13083234c74f2720f31:37

value
24291621
script pubkey
OP_0 OP_PUSHBYTES_20 16067233add719181af0533d26999d5bc4032ef2
address
bc1qzcr8yvad6uv3sxhs2v7jdxvat0zqxthjaks94t
transaction
def6c25afb40d18df0ba72427a5a217996a0aa29d06ba13083234c74f2720f31
spent
true